The Girl by the Roadside 1917
The Girl by the Roadside (1917) is a gripping mystery film directed by Theodore Marston. The movie follows Judith Ralston, a young woman left in a small Virginia town by her brother and his wife, who are counterfeiters.

About The Girl by the Roadside (1917) — A Gripping Mystery Unfolds
The Girl by the Roadside (1917) is a gripping mystery film directed by Theodore Marston. The movie follows Judith Ralston, a young woman left in a small Virginia town by her brother and his wife, who are counterfeiters. As Judith navigates her new surroundings, she finds herself at the center of a secret service agent's investigation. With its blend of suspense and intrigue, The Girl by the Roadside is a thrilling ride that keeps viewers on the edge of their seats.
As Judith Ralston interacts with the people around her, including the kind-hearted Boone Pendleton, she must confront the danger that surrounds her.
